Two Arrested on Drug Charges Following Traffic Stop on Bunker Street
Cambridge, MD - Two individuals face drug possession charges following a police response to reported Controlled Dangerous Substance/Drug Violations in the 300 block of Bunker Street earlier this week.
On January 6, 2026, at approximately 10:03 p.m., officers from the Cambridge Police Department responded to a call regarding suspicious activity.
Dispatch provided officers with a description of a vehicle where the alleged violations were taking place.
Upon arrival at the scene, officers located the vehicle matching the description. Inside the vehicle were two occupants, identified as 33-year-old Whitney Nicole Gross of Centreville, MD, and 47-year-old James Cecil McCoy Jr. of Cambridge, MD.
According to police reports, officers observed drug paraphernalia in plain view while speaking with the occupants. Gross and McCoy were asked to exit the vehicle to facilitate a search, during which additional paraphernalia was discovered.
Both subjects were placed under arrest at the scene. A further search of the vehicle revealed cocaine and a plastic bag containing a quantity of an unknown substance.
Authorities stated that the unknown substance has been sent to a laboratory for further testing and identification.
During a search of his person, McCoy was also found to be in possession of heroin.
Gross and McCoy were issued criminal citations and subsequently released. Both individuals have been charged with CDS Possession (Not Cannabis) and CDS Possession of Paraphernalia.
The investigation remains ongoing pending the results of the laboratory analysis.
